A 23-year-old British man has been arrested in France and charged with murder two years after a dad, aged 38, was found stabbed to death in Norwich.
Jahziah Harrison, of Northampton Park, London, appeared before Norwich Magistrates’ Court after being arrested by French police earlier this month. Three further arrests have also been made in Islington, London, in connection with the incident.
On Friday 2 August 2024 officers were called to reports a man had been stabbed. Despite the best efforts of emergency services, the man – later identified as 38-year-old Oliver Payne – was pronounced dead at the scene.

Nearly two years on from the incident police have issued a major update in the case. A Norfolk Police spokesperson said: “A 23-year-old British man has appeared in court charged with murder of a man in Norwich, having been arrested in France and returned to the UK.
“Jahziah Harrison aged 23 and of Northampton Park, London appeared before Norwich Magistrates Court on Tuesday 21 July 2026 and was charged with the murder of Oliver Payne in Paragon Place, Norwich, on 2 August 2024.
“He was also charged with manslaughter, possession of a bladed article, two counts of drug supply offences and perverting the course of justice.
“The charges relate to an incident on Friday 2 August 2024 when officers were called to reports a man had been stabbed. Despite the best efforts of emergency services, the man – later identified as 38-year-old Oliver Payne – was pronounced dead at the scene.
“He was further charged with a second count of possession of a bladed article, two counts of grievous bodily harm, two counts of drug supply offences in relation to a separate incident.
“On 6 July 2026, the French authorities arrested Jahziah Harrison and began the legal process to return him to the UK on Monday 20 July 2026. Today (Tuesday 21 July 2026), he has been further remanded into custody and is next due to appear at Norwich Crown Court on 1 February 2027.
“Three further arrests have been made in Islington, London, in connection with the incident. On Friday 17 July 2026, two women aged in their 20s and a woman aged in her 60s were arrested on suspicion of assisting an offender. They were all taken to Wood Green Police Investigation Centre for questioning and have since all been released under investigation.”
